These are some stories about people who died in 1983

On the surface the “People who died in 1983” stories are simple. They are stories about people who died in 1983. People who died in other years will just have to wait until the Best American Series puts out a book in their year. Still, people have asked, “Why 1983?” That’s a little more complicated, but if I want to make it as simple as possible I’ll just be honest and say it came down to me having a pretty big ego.

You see I was born in the last days of 1983. I was one of its last creations. After a year of heartache and deaths it seemed like 1983 could care less about the trouble of another human. I came out a half finished product on the 343rd day of 1983. I should have been a model of perfection, but after a long life ‘83 was burnt out and just wanted to move on to what was next. And twelve days later just like all the other years, except those odd years who wait an extra day, ’83 quietly blew itself out and gave way to new year.

So, as much as it is about the people who died in ’83 and about the people writing about those deaths, it is also a little about me. You could say I’m curious. I’ve wondering vaguely about reincarnation over the years and I’ve come to the conclusion that if it exists it will take place in the following fashion, a person dies then a few days, weeks, months later they are brought back to life in a new birth. Not a profound thought by any means, but one that you can’t help wonder about.

Before I ramble on too long, let me just say there’s bound to be a lot of good writing taking place on the topic of 1983 from a wide variety of people. I hope I haven’t ruined anything with my confessions. I made them with the best intentions in mind. I will now step aside and hopefully let you enjoy all the writings that will take place.

-Mark Baumer
